Conditions Treated by Endocrinologists
The services of the Endocrine Clinics include diagnosis, follow-up, and treatment for:
- Type 1, Type 2, and gestational diabetes.
- Thyroid disorders, including hypothyroidism and hyperthyroidism.
- Parathyroid diseases and calcium disorders.
- Pituitary and adrenal gland diseases.
- Hormonal disorders in men and women.
- Obesity and hormone-related metabolic disorders.
- Osteoporosis caused by hormonal imbalances.
- Growth and puberty disorders.

Endocrine Diseases FAQs
What symptoms require visiting an endocrinologist?
Symptoms of endocrine disorders vary and include chronic fatigue, unexplained weight changes, excessive thirst and urination, mood swings, menstrual irregularities, hair loss, or a rapid heart rate. Visiting an endocrinologist is recommended to evaluate hormone levels and ensure early diagnosis.

How are thyroid disorders diagnosed and treated at the hospital?
Thyroid disorders (hypothyroidism, hyperthyroidism, or thyroid nodules) are evaluated using advanced hormonal blood tests and ultrasound imaging, followed by tailored medical treatments or necessary interventions.
Do endocrinologists treat obesity and metabolic disorders?
Yes, obesity cases are thoroughly evaluated to check for underlying hormonal causes (such as adrenal or thyroid disorders). Our endocrinologists offer integrated treatment solutions to help regulate metabolism and weight safely according to medical standards.
